Northwell Health and Nuvance Health Merge for Integrated Health System

As part of the agreement, Northwell will invest at least $1 billion in Nuvance hospitals.

By HFT Staff


Northwell Health and Nuvance Health announced the two nonprofit health systems have officially joined together to form a new integrated regional health system that will enhance care for communities across greater New York and Connecticut, serving a population of more than 13 million. 

The integrated system, with a combined $22.6 billion operating budget, now encompasses over 104,000 employees, a diverse network of 22,000 nurses and 13,500 providers at 28 hospitals, more than 1,050 ambulatory care and 73 urgent care locations. 

The New York State Department of Health and Connecticut Office of Health Strategy, along with the attorneys general of each state, approved plans for the integrated health system, which received final clearance after the board of trustees from both organizations voted to move forward. As part of the agreement, Northwell will invest at least $1 billion in Nuvance hospitals.
